Abishiekh Jain is a 16 years old student who studies in 12th standard. An avid book reader, Abishiekh studies both online and offline to keep himself productive.His personal experience coupled with zeal to know about technology, enabled him to start Hackers Den, which is a technology blog offering informative articles about tips, tricks, and how-to.Abishiekh wants to see his blog gaining popularity in the coming 3 years and would like to change the view of people when they hear words like Hacking and programming.

Please provide a brief overview of your product/ service.

Basically, Hackers Den is a technology blog about tricks. We are a bunch of geeks, with myself leading the crew. We try all the possible ways to bring the cooler hacks of all time, and we make sure our extensive research brings you the best.Through this website and page Hackers Den we ensure that none of our supporters or fans are disappointed by our tricks

What inspired you to build the above product/ service?

My enemy. I will tell you the entire story. Actually, I was in 6th standard and I didn’t know anything about online market, mobile apps, and hated computer a lot. I was a nerd who was always into books. One day, my enemy came to me and boasted in front of girlsabout how he can hack accounts. He told me to go back home and wait for him to hack my account to send messages from my account to all the girls. I was scared but, he didn’t do anything as he didn’t know anything about hacking. The next day I asked him, ‘Why didn’t you hack?’ He said, ‘I took pity on you.’ And I was like, ‘Thanks so much.’That same day I went online and I started learning about these things.

What was the most challenging part of your journey till now?

The most challenging part was to earn money online.Next challenge is to manage time.

How did you overcome those challenges?

I started earning money after a year of blogging. My major source of income wasAdsense.With the help of Salman, I learned about sponsored posts and reviews, which started giving me a decent amount of money. After Adsense disproved my blog deducting 140$, Ithought about making my blogAdFree and earn from various other sources to keep it alive.The second challenge I face is managing time. I use a scheduler app and it makes me more productive.
